Heating Technology Efficiency

Choosing ceiling mounted radiant panels involves considering several factors that impact heating technology efficiency. This type of radiant heating warms objects and surfaces directly, reducing energy loss through air circulation, which is great for allergy sufferers. Systems like infrared panels can reach high temperatures—up to 248°F—while using lower wattages, cutting down on your electricity bill. Many 500W panels effectively heat areas up to 12H in a 10 x 10 space, providing targeted warmth where you need it most. High-density thermal insulation in these panels minimizes heat loss, boosting overall energy efficiency. Plus, infrared technology usually requires less maintenance compared to traditional systems, as there’s no dust-stirring fans to clean regularly.

Installation Flexibility Options

Ceiling mounted radiant panels offer several installation flexibility options that cater to your specific needs and room layout. You can choose from various configurations, such as surface mounting, recessed installation, or integrating them into T-bar suspended ceilings. This adaptability maximizes the utilization of wall and floor space, keeping your living areas unobstructed. Many panels come with included installation hardware and flexible power cords, making setup simple and potentially eliminating the need for professional help. If you’re using T-bar ceilings, some panels can drop easily into existing grid systems, allowing for quick installation without major renovations. Just be sure to take into account the depth and weight of the panels to guarantee compatibility with your ceiling structure for secure mounting.

Size and Coverage Area

Understanding the size and coverage area of ceiling mounted radiant panels is essential for effective heating in your space. The panel size, typically measured in inches, influences heat delivery, with common dimensions like 48 x 24 inches. Coverage area matters too; some panels can efficiently heat a 10 x 10 area, while others vary. Pay attention to wattage ratings, usually between 500W and 1500W, as they determine the space you can effectively heat. For instance, a 500W panel produces about 1707 BTUs, indicating its heating power. Finally, consider the panel’s depth—around 1 inch—which impacts installation and how discreetly it fits into your environment. Choosing the right size and coverage guarantees peak comfort and efficiency in your heating solutions.

Safety Features Included

When you’re selecting ceiling mounted radiant panels, safety features are just as important as size and coverage. Look for models with mesh backing on louvers to prevent foreign objects from entering and enhancing user safety. Many units come equipped with overheat protection sensors that automatically turn off the panel if it exceeds safe temperature limits, giving you peace of mind. Additionally, consider panels made from heavy-duty materials for durability against wear and tear. If you’re planning outdoor installations, check for IP ratings like IPX4 to guarantee resistance to dust and water. User-friendly designs may also include fan delays, preventing cold air discharge before the heating elements warm up, guaranteeing a more comfortable experience.

Power Consumption Requirements

Power consumption is a key factor in selecting ceiling-mounted radiant panels, with options typically ranging from 500W to 1500W. The wattage directly affects both heating capacity and energy consumption. For instance, a 1000W heater uses 1 kWh per hour, impacting your electricity bills. You’ll also want to take into account the voltage requirements; most panels operate on 120V or 240V, which could affect compatibility with your existing wiring. Additionally, assess the BTU output, as a 500W panel produces about 1707 BTUs, suitable for efficiently warming specific areas. Finally, check the amp ratings; higher amperage means a greater power draw, possibly requiring electrical upgrades for safe installation. Choose wisely to balance comfort with energy efficiency.
